ROLE
As part of the Service and Small Projects (S & SP), the Assistant Project Manager (APM) supports the Project Manager as the lead administrative person on the Project responsible for managing the Project documents, including financials, construction documents, and subcontractor submissions. The APM is responsible for the orderly flow of information between I-Grace, subcontractors and vendors.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- The APM is responsible for maintaining updated budgets and Buyout worksheets, processing Change Orders and Trade Awards, maintaining logs, processing subcontractor/vendor invoices, and preparing Waivers of Lien.
- Preparing Commitment documents and contracts with subcontractors and suppliers as directed by Project Manager or Project Executive.
- The APM may participate in the buy-out of minor scopes (e.g. glazing, bath accessories, etc.).
- At the direction of the Project Manager or Super, the APM orders incidental materials and tools for the field and prepares in-house schedules (e.g. doors, hardware, accessories, etc.).
- The APM is responsible for the dissemination, tracking, updating and filing of all Architectural, Engineering and Consultant Drawings and Specifications; SK’s and other Submittals (e.g. RFI’s, Shop Drawings, and samples) and maintaining associated Logs.
- Assists Project Manager in preparation of Project Reports such as field, meeting minutes, tracking logs, and change orders.
- Prepares and revises punch list in cooperation with the Superintendent and Project Manager.
- Maintains Project Files in binders of all documentation as well as electronic files as per Company policy.
- Prepares the Owners Service and Maintenance Manuals, in cooperation with the Site Superintendent and Project Manager, for delivery to the Owner, Building Superintendent and our Service & Maintenance division.
QUALIFICATIONS
- 2+ years experience in high-end residential construction, facilities management.
- Proficient in Sage 300/Timberline, Construction Accounting, MS Project & MS Office Suite.
- 4-year college degree in Architecture, Construction Management, or Engineering preferred.
